Exploring the Wonders of Pachostar
- 108 Views
- Blogger
- April 14, 2023
- Uncategorized
Introduction to Pachostar
Pachostar is a cloud-native, open-source data platform that enables enterprises to store, process, and analyze large amounts of data. The platform is designed to be highly scalable, fault-tolerant, and flexible, making it suitable for a wide range of use cases. Pachostar has gained popularity in recent years due to its ability to simplify data management and analysis, making it easier for organizations to derive insights from their data.
Architecture of Pachostar
Pachostar has a distributed architecture that enables it to scale horizontally to handle large amounts of data. The architecture is built around the concept of “data pipelines,” which are sequences of processing stages that transform data from its raw form into a format suitable for analysis. Pachostar’s architecture consists of four main components: Pachd, PFS (Pachyderm File System), Pachctl, and Pachyderm Hub.
Pachd is the core component of the Pachostar platform. It manages the data pipelines and the processing of data within the pipelines. PFS is the distributed file system used by Pachostar to store data. Pachctl is the command-line interface (CLI) used to interact with Pachostar. Pachyderm Hub is a managed service that provides a simplified interface for working with Pachostar.
Features of Pachostar
Pachostar has several features that make it a powerful data platform for enterprises. One of the key features is its ability to handle large amounts of data. Pachostar can process petabytes of data, making it suitable for enterprises with large datasets. Another key feature is its scalability. Pachostar’s distributed architecture enables it to scale horizontally to handle increasing amounts of data.
Pachostar also has a flexible data processing model. It supports batch processing, real-time processing, and stream processing, making it suitable for a wide range of use cases. Pachostar also supports multiple programming languages, including Python, Go, and Java, enabling developers to use the language of their choice.
Pachostar has several other features that make it a powerful data platform, including version control for data, data lineage tracking, and support for machine learning workflows.
Use Cases of Pachostar
Pachostar is used by a wide range of organizations for various use cases. One of the most common use cases is data engineering. Pachostar is used by data engineers to build data pipelines that transform raw data into a format suitable for analysis. Pachostar’s flexible data processing model and support for multiple programming languages make it ideal for this use case.
Pachostar is also used for data science and machine learning. Data scientists use Pachostar to build machine learning models and to train them on large datasets. Pachostar’s support for version control and data lineage tracking makes it easy for data scientists to track changes to their models and datasets.
Pachostar is also used for data analytics. Organizations use Pachostar to store and analyze large amounts of data, enabling them to derive insights and make informed decisions.
Advantages of Pachostar
Pachostar has several advantages that make it a popular data platform. One of the key advantages is its flexibility. Pachostar’s flexible data processing model and support for multiple programming languages make it easy for organizations to build data pipelines and machine learning workflows using the tools and languages they are familiar with.
Pachostar is also highly scalable. Its distributed architecture enables it to scale horizontally to handle increasing amounts of data, making it suitable for enterprises with large datasets.
Pachostar’s version control and data lineage tracking features are also significant advantages.